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Edit content field and remove type field from clipboard.yml credits file #2808

Closed
5 tasks done
Tracked by #2775
answebdev opened this issue Feb 20, 2022 · 3 comments · Fixed by #3291
Closed
5 tasks done
Tracked by #2775

Edit content field and remove type field from clipboard.yml credits file #2808

answebdev opened this issue Feb 20, 2022 · 3 comments · Fixed by #3291
Assignees
Labels
good first issue Good for newcomers P-Feature: Credit https://www.hackforla.org/credits/ role: back end/devOps Tasks for back-end developers role: front end Tasks for front end developers size: 0.5pt Can be done in 3 hours or less

Comments

@answebdev
Copy link
Member

answebdev commented Feb 20, 2022

Prerequisite

  1. Be a member of Hack for LA. (There are no fees to join.) If you have not joined yet, please follow the steps on our Getting Started page.
  2. Please make sure you have read our Hack for LA Contributing Guide before you claim/start working on an issue.

Overview

As a developer, I want to edit the content field and remove the type field from a credit's yml file so that redundant code is removed and the code is easier to understand.

Details

Currently, in each credit's yml file, there is a content field and a type field, which contains similar information. Since the fields are redundant, we decided to remove the type field.

Also, we changed the content field to the content-type field to make it clearer what its purpose is. The possible values for content-type field are image, video, or audio; other types of content can be added if necessary. In the future, this will allow developers a way to differentiate easily between different types of content in order to show each credit's media file correctly on the website.

Action Items

For the file _data/internal/credits/clipboard.yml, do the following:

Resources/Instructions

File and Code links you will need to work on this issue

@answebdev answebdev added good first issue Good for newcomers role: front end Tasks for front end developers role: back end/devOps Tasks for back-end developers P-Feature: Credit https://www.hackforla.org/credits/ size: 0.5pt Can be done in 3 hours or less labels Feb 20, 2022
@github-actions

This comment was marked as outdated.

@JessicaLucindaCheng JessicaLucindaCheng changed the title Edit content field and remove type field from clipboard.yml file Edit content field and remove type field from clipboard.yml credits file Feb 24, 2022
@JessicaLucindaCheng JessicaLucindaCheng added this to the y. Technical debt milestone Mar 9, 2022
@tunglinn tunglinn self-assigned this Jun 22, 2022
@tunglinn
Copy link
Member

Availability for this week: any day
My estimated ETA for completing this issue: 6/23/2022

@tunglinn
Copy link
Member

tunglinn commented Jun 23, 2022

Provide Update

  1. Progress: Completed issue action items
  2. Blockers: PR reviews
  3. Availability: 6/23-6/24
  4. ETA: 6/23

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
good first issue Good for newcomers P-Feature: Credit https://www.hackforla.org/credits/ role: back end/devOps Tasks for back-end developers role: front end Tasks for front end developers size: 0.5pt Can be done in 3 hours or less
Projects
Development

Successfully merging a pull request may close this issue.

4 participants